Description

The new CP-WX8240 projector is geared up for simple and user-friendly functionality in any environment. With a convenient motorised lens shift, and a central lens position, images can be seamlessly adjusted and moved at the touch of a button. Plus, with a wide range of optional lenses, the CP-WX8240 can adapt to any environment, from conference rooms and lecture theatres, to museums or anywhere requiring a creative solution.

Features at a glance

  • 3LCD3LCD – A sophisticated, innovative technology that utilises 3 chips to deliver vibrant, true-to-life and consistent images for the most demanding audiences.
  • Hybrid FilterHybrid Filter – The Hybrid Filter lasts for more than 4000 hours, ten times longer than conventional filters. This extension in maintenance intervals reduces the overall cost of ownership significantly.
  • Security featuresSecurity features – Advanced security features include Multi-Level PIN-Lock, Transition Detector, steel security bar, Kensington Lock and prominent security labels.
  • Blackboard/Whiteboard ModeBlackboard/Whiteboard Mode – Projecting onto coloured or shiny backgrounds can make images appear either dull or uncomfortably bright. This mode ensures optimal brightness whether the screen is black, green or shiny white.
  • Low TCOLow TCO – Significantly extended maintenance intervals resulting from long-life parts reduces the total cost of ownership.
  • Optional LensesOptional Lenses – Installations are more flexible with a range of optional bayonet lenses. Choose from Fixed Short, Short, Long and Ultra Long throw lenses, designed to suit different requirements.
  • PC-less PresentationsPC-less Presentations – Simply plug in a memory stick, SD card, or even a portable hard disk drive and present without the need of a laptop.
  • Vertical ProjectionVertical Projection – Images can be projected at 90 degrees up or down, opening up a whole new range of applications.
  • Advanced NetworkingAdvanced Networking – Manage and control multiple projectors over LAN. Turn the projector on and off, schedule email alerts and monitor projectors all via the network.
  • Wireless NetworkingWireless Networking – Wireless networking offers quick, easy and secure network access. Browser based software provides easy management, control and monitoring of networked projectors.
  • AMX Device DiscoveryAMX Device Discovery – When integrated with an AMX Controller, the relevant communication modules and drivers are downloaded to the projector automatically.
  • HDMIHDMI – Get the highest quality image by connecting the latest in A/V equipment to the projector with HDMI (High-Definition Multimedia Interface).
  • Long Life LampLong Life Lamp – Using Eco Mode, lamp life is extended to more than 6,000 hours – equivalent to the projector being used for three hours a day over a period of ten years.
  • Template FunctionTemplate Function – This unique Hitachi feature allows you to project different patterns of lines and grids onto a whiteboard, blackboard or flip chart, making writing and drawing easier.
  • Virtually Maintenance FreeVirtually Maintenance Free – Hitachi projectors are designed to be easy to use and require minimal maintenance. Long-life parts significantly extend the maintenance intervals, reducing cost and any inconvenience.
  • Daytime ModeDaytime Mode – It can be harder to see a projected picture when the sun is shining brightly. Projections are always vivid and colourful in a bright environment with Daytime Mode.
  • Quick On/OffQuick On/Off – Plug in, turn on and present. The Quick On/Off feature and automatic resolution equals fast set-up
  • Input Source NamingInput Source Naming – Personalise devices and inputs to the projector – for example, re-name a device input to “Tom’s Laptop” for easy recognition.
  • Ultra QuietUltra Quiet – With a low noise level of 29dB in our latest models, the internal fan is one of the quietest in its class. The audience will hear the presenter, not the operating noise of the projector.
  • My ButtonMy Button – Assign custom functions or common tasks to a programmable button on your remote control.
  • MessengerMessenger – Send text messages and announcements to multiple, networked projectors at the same time. This is ideal for projecting daily work schedules and university campus notifications to multiple classrooms simultaneously.
  • Centralised Reporting FunctionCentralised Reporting Function – Using a single PC, create HTML reports for a group of networked projectors to simplify maintenance requirements.
  • Audio Pass ThroughAudio Pass Through – When all you need is sound and not pictures, this convenient feature lets you hear the projector’s speakers whilst the rest is on stand-by – helping to preserve lamplife.
  • Vertical Keystone CorrectionVertical Keystone Correction – Correct misaligned images automatically with vertical keystone correction.
  • Progressive ScanProgressive Scan – Typically with moving images, each frame of video is shown in two halves – odd lines and even lines. Progressive Scan enables every line of a video frame to be displayed simultaneously resulting in crisp, smooth motion and reduced flicker and judder.
  • On Screen Display (OSD)On Screen Display (OSD) – The new menu is much easier to use. Navigating through the different options is easier, whilst settings are clearly named.
  • Energy Efficiency SaverEnergy Efficiency Saver – Hitachi are ECO conscious when developing LCD TVs, focussing on low energy consumption, responsible choice of materials and using the best technologies available.

Product Specs

OPTICAL

LCD Panel 0.59″ (1.5cm) P-Si TFT x 3
Resolution WXGA (1280 x 800)
  **A free replacement lamp will be issued if the original lamp fails within 6 months from the date of purchase.
Light Output (Brightness) 4000 ANSI Lumens (Normal Mode)
2700 ANSI Lumens (Eco Mode)
Colour Light Output (Colour Brightness) 4000 ANSI Lumens (Normal Mode)
2700 ANSI Lumens (Eco Mode)
Contrast Ratio 3000:1 (Presentation Mode)
Lens Powered Zoom x 1.5, Powered Focus
Lamp Wattage 245W UHP
Lamp Life 2500 Hours (Normal Mode)/4000 Hours (Eco Mode)*
Distance To Width Ratio (:1) 1.50 (WIDE), 2.2 (TELE)
Diagonal Display Size 30″~600″ (76cm~1,524cm)
Number Of Colours 8 Bit/colour, 16.7M colours
Keystone Vertical 5:-1 shift, Normal at + 17.7°~11.9° projection angle
  *The stated lamp life refers to the average life expected in ideal operating conditions with usage in accordance with the manual. The majority of, but not all lamps should achieve this figure.
